Apply here: https://grnh.se/9ccd63f31
About SimilarWeb
SimilarWeb has been named one of CALCALIST'S TOP 50 STARTUPS 2019 and one of the 10 MOST DESIRABLE ISRAELI COMPANIES TO WORK FOR. Similarweb is also ranked 8th in DUN’S BEST HIGH TECH COMPANIES TO WORK FOR IN ISRAEL in 2018, taking over companies such as Amazon, Mobileye, PayPal, Ebay and more.
What makes the SimilarWeb R&D team awesome?
We love data! At SimilarWeb you have the opportunity to work with it on a petabyte scale!
As part of the team you will support backend for our multi million client side panel across all platforms through our massive ingest pipeline in cloud (Big data starts with ingesting even bigger data. Our Node.js, Kinesis, Java, Python, Go pipeline is impressive!)
We are solving some really complex problems with web server scale, algorithms on the client side, research of different OS’s and APIs, managing multi million users products and more.
Work with cutting edge technology - we often beta test the tech that other people will only discover next year!
We want you to get better and help you set goals and conquer them
A day to day as a Server Developer at SimilarWeb means...
You will be a server side developer, who is passionate about learning new technologies and handling a multitude of systems, and can fit in a small team of independent developers. You will develop and integrate systems that retrieve and analyze data from around the web from millions of users.
On a day to day you will:
Take a major part in designing and implementing complex high scale systems using large variety of technologies
Design, code and integrate huge scale systems written in Node.js, Java, Go & more
Implement solutions in AWS cloud environment
Learn new stuff and enrich other team members
Perform code reviews, evaluate implementations, and provide feedback about potential tool improvements
What will I bring to the team?
BSc degree in Computer Science, a related technical field of study, or equivalent practical experience.
At least 3 years of server side Software development experience in one or more general purpose programming languages.
Experience working with two or more from the following: Web application development, Unix/Linux environments, distributed and parallel systems, machine learning, information retrieval, networking, developing large software systems.
Experience with one or more general purpose programming languages, including but not limited to: Java, C/C++, C#, Python, JavaScript, Scala or Go
Comfortable taking challenges and learning new technologies, including new coding languages.
Experience with large scale production systems
Excellent communication skills with the ability to provide constant dialog between engineering teams
Ability to prioritize tasks and work independently
Excellent reliability, dependability, and trustworthiness
Strong sense of ownership over the products of the team
Comfortable working in a dynamic environment
It’s a plus if you also have:
Experience with large scale production systems
Familiarity with Big Data technologies such as Hadoop, Spark, HDFS, Airflow, HBase, etc.
Apply here: https://grnh.se/9ccd63f31